Understanding the Market
Before diving into particular models, it's important to understand the numerous types of treadmills offered on the market. Typically, the following categories exist:
Manual Treadmills: These are more economical and do not need a motor; they count on the user's effort to move the belt.Electric Treadmills: These are the most common types and are powered by a motor. They normally provide more functions than manual treadmills.Folding Treadmills: Ideal for small spaces, these treadmills can be folded for simpler storage.Industrial Treadmills: Though more expensive, these treadmills are created for heavy use in fitness centers and gym.
While cheap treadmills can be found in different classifications, this guide will mainly concentrate on cost effective electric alternatives, as they provide a balance of functions, functionality, and value for cash.
What to Look For in a Cheap Treadmill
When looking for a budget-friendly treadmill, think about the following key functions:
1. Motor PowerUnder 2.0 CHP (Continuous Horsepower): Suitable for walking and light running.2.0 to 2.5 CHP: Fair for most users, accommodating running and walking.Above 2.5 CHP: Ideal for runners and those using the treadmill regularly.2. Size and Weight CapacityRunning Surface: At least 50 inches long and 16 inches broad for walking; 55 to 60 inches long for running.Weight Capacity: Most cheap treadmills can support 220 to 300 pounds; understand your weight requirements.3. FunctionsPre-set Workouts: Built-in programs can direct users based on physical fitness objectives.Heart Rate Monitors: Essential for those focusing on cardiovascular health.Slope Settings: Provides variety in exercises; manual or electric systems offered.4. Service warranty
An excellent guarantee reflects the producer's self-confidence in their item. Search for:
Frame Warranty: At least 10 years.Motor Warranty: 1-3 years.Parts and Labor: 90 days to 1 year.5. Consumer Reviews
Reading real user experiences can light up potential advantages and disadvantages not covered in requirements.

Maintenance and Longevity
While affordable treadmills will not bring the premium features of high-end designs, appropriate upkeep can extend their life expectancy:
Regular Cleaning: Wipe down the surface area and ensure no dust clogs systems.Lubrication: Use lube on the belt as suggested by manufacturers.Inspect Hardware: Periodically tighten up bolts and examine for wear and tear.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)1. Are cheap treadmills reputable?
